Yes the Triton edition does have pretty much 1 sample to each note of a multilsample and to cram all that data into half the memory on the pa1X something would have to go.

I believe you would end up with 1 sample to ever 3 notes for the majority of the multisamples. At this point I don’t have any idea of why that would affect the sound. But this is after all only and idea at the moment.

It’s also worth mentioning that anyone who already owns the Triton Edition would not be expected to purchase the Pa1X Edition. You would get it for free.

Hi rbeach.

As it stands right now, none of the programs would sound right since they all exceed the number of effects you can use at the same time on your Pa1X.

The fact that it takes twice the maximum amount of memory your Pa1X has to load Vocal Assault doesn’t help matters either.

It is possible to convert the data and get it running fairly close to the original version, but it really would be a serious amount of work. Somthing best left to me if this goes ahead. I just know the data inside out.

As for Awave. Yeah that’s a great program, but personally I prefer the actual system within the Korg keyboards. It’s quicker.
